Introduction to TCP/IP and OSI Models
TCP/IP: Developed by the Department of Defense for the Internet.
OSI: Developed by the ISO to create a universal networking framework.
Both models provide layered approaches for network communication.
3
Transmission Control Protocol/Internet Protocol (TCP/IP)
A four-layer model.
Originally designed to create a robust network for military communicatio
Used by internet applications like email, web browsers, FTP, etc.

Layers of the TCP/IP Model
1.
Link Layer: Handles physical and logical connections.
2.
Internet Layer: Routes data using IP addresses.
3.
Transport Layer: Manages end-to-end communication (TCP/UDP).
4.
Application Layer: Supports network applications (FTP, HTTP,
SMTP).

Open Systems Interconnection (OSI) Model
A theoretical model with seven layers.
Developed by ISO to standardize network communication.
Helps understand data transmission from source to destination.

OSI Model Layers
Physical Layer: Handles physical data transmission.
Data Link Layer: Manages error detection and correction.
Network Layer: Translates network addresses and routes data.
Transport Layer: Ensures reliable data transmission.
Session Layer: Establishes and manages sessions.
Presentation Layer: Converts data formats.
Application Layer: Interface for applications (email, FTP, browsers).
